## Add encoding detection for uploaded text files

Support kept seeing garbled imports from Veltrix customers on Windows exports. This PR adds charset sniffing to the Quillbox upload pipeline: we check BOM first, then run a confidence-scored detector, then fall back to Latin-1. Files above the size cap are sampled, not fully scanned. No user-facing changes except fewer mojibake tickets. Detection behavior is driven entirely by the constants below, so escalate before suggesting changes to them.

limits module of kahag-fajop:
QUOTAS = {
    "wenwyn": 10,
    "zorath": 1,
}

During the migration from the Keystone badge system to Lattice Pass, visitor handling at the Fenwick Street office changes slightly. Team assistants should continue to pre-register guests the day before, but printed visitor passes will no longer open the turnstiles until the cutover completes. Instead, escort visitors through the side gate and sign them in manually at the desk. Escorts must remain with guests at all times. For the side gate, use the interim code shown below.

staff pass of kawip-hawef = bdg-QLP-2

## Crossword service — onboarding

Gridsmith generates daily puzzles from the Lexhaven word bank. Pipeline: candidate grid → fill solver → clue picker → review queue. Solver runs on the batch pool; don't scale it manually. Clue picker calls the internal Phraseworks service for difficulty scoring — that dependency is the usual failure point, raise it at the weekly sync if latency drifts past 2s. Local dev needs the Phraseworks staging key, provisioned per engineer. For the shared CI runner, use the key below.

gateway credential: kto3_qfe

### Changed

Renamed `CHIRPD_SAMPLE_PCT` to `CHIRPD_LOG_SAMPLE_RATE` because the old name confused literally everyone — it was a ratio, not a percent. Chirpd is our chattiest service, so sampling at 0.05 keeps the log bill sane. The old key still works until next release but logs a warning. While you're editing the env file anyway, add this line beneath the sampling setting.

env line for yahag-kajog: VAULT_KEY13=e1c568d90102d